a tropical fruit with a funny name
Camu Camu is sometimes referred to as rumberry and grows in the wild in the Amazon rainforest, mainly in Peru, Colombia, Ecuador and Brazil. This low -growing shrub thrives in swamps or along the banks of lakes and streams - places where the roots and the lower trunk of the plant remain under immersed. (Source)
Camu Camu belongs to the Myrten family (Myrtaceae) and is related to Guave, Piment, Nelke and Rosenapfel. The indigenous people living in the Amazon area are very sour and acidic and harvest the fruits of canoes. People have recently started to cultivate Camu Camu to sell it to global markets.
In his book Tales of a Shaman’s Apprentice , the ethnobotanist Mark Plotkin once wrote that a forest population of Camu Camu is “worth twice as much as with picking up and replacing the forest with cattle”. He believed that the local cultivation of Camu Camu is promising for the support of the local economy in the Amazon area.

offers a strong dose of vitamin c.
The nutrient composition of Camu Camu is unsurpassed. For the beginning, the fruit has a ton of vitamin C-also known as L-Ascorbic acid. In addition to Acerola cherry, another tropical fruit, Camu Camu is one of the world's richest foods in the world. 100 ripening degrees Camu Camu contains depending on the maturity of the ripening 1882 to 2280 mg of vegetable vitamin C. has a strong antioxidant force
vitamin C itself is a strong antioxidant, but Camu Camu contains several other natural secondary plant substances that contribute to its skills to intercept free radicals. It contains polyphenols, flavonoids and more. ((Link removed))
polyphenols: tannine, style, lignane
Camu Camu also has the highest phenol content of all fruits. Most people obtain their polyphenols from chocolate, coffee and wine, with fruit and vegetables in the last place. Change that!
A polyphenol in Camu Camu is a connection that is also contained in rosemary, rosemary acid. It resembles coffee acid and acts as strong antioxidants in the body. Camu Camu also has ellagic acid, another strong polyphenol that is known that it promotes a normal response to inflammation. Other useful polyphenols in Camu Camu include tannins, stylish and lignan. However, flavonoids are the largest category of polyphenols - they occur so often that they receive their own description below. ((Link removed))
Flavonoids: Anthocyane, Quercetin & more
flavonoids have numerous advantages, such as the protection of the nervous system and the heart from damage and promoting a normal response to inflammation. A main flavonoid in Camu Camu are his anthocyans, of which they may have heard of. These are usually pigments contained in fruit and vegetables. ((Link removed))
The most important anthocyans in Camu Camu are glucoside, quercetin and kaempferol. Roccentin is now a popular nutrient that promotes normal response to inflammation. You can also find quercetin in olive oil, grapes, citrus fruits and berries. ((Link removed))
loaded with minerals
Camu Camu is not only a rich source of vitamin C and antioxidants, but also contains considerable amounts of potassium, calcium and magnesium as well as trace elements such as zinc, manganese and copper. ((Link removed))

best ways to take Camu Camu
According to a Spanish study, Camu Camu is used as a juice and to season ice cream. The Japanese use the Camu berries commercially and add both food and cosmetics. Very few people eat Camu Camu raw - and most of them live in the Amazon area where the plant grows. Most people consume the fruits in juice, puree or pulp shape.
lisa q., a certified raw food teacher, enjoys the variety that adds Camu Camu to her smoothies, herbal sorbets and other raw vegan dishes. "It has a subtle bitterness that gives the dishes an interesting note," she says. "Even if you always like to eat the same dish, it is fun to turn things upside down."
